Council approves Casey’s site plan for convenience store with 4–1 vote; hours and plat conditions applied

The West Des Moines City Council on July 7 approved a preliminary plat and site plan for a Casey’s convenience store that includes a 4,200‑square‑foot building and eight fuel pumps.
The resolution passed with a 4‑yes, 1‑no vote. The council attached two conditions of approval: the applicant acknowledged that no building permit will be issued before the final plat is approved by the city council, and the convenience store hours of operation will be limited to 5 a.m. to 11 p.m. daily.
No members of the public spoke on the item during the meeting. The council did not elaborate on the basis for the lone no vote on the record during the July 7 session. Staff described the item as having no outstanding issues but included the two conditions in the approval.
The applicant must comply with the conditions before construction permits may be issued.
